Output 05aa98e1f4b37a16f6f1923029602b0cf758188f11bd38cf4605b58593710ada:0

value
2408641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4586f3ca528e7330e8453f2bd6714fcb64cd3de OP_EQUAL
address
3GfzgYPiYXpAwQUQ6VStwHHt12iZgyRgrs
transaction
05aa98e1f4b37a16f6f1923029602b0cf758188f11bd38cf4605b58593710ada
confirmations
300385
spent
true